What is the deadline to file a lien claim in Bonneville County, Idaho?

In Idaho, your deadline to file a mechanics lien is dependent upon your role in the project. In general:
General contractors have 90 days to file a lien after the date of last furnishing. Subcontractors and suppliers have 90 days to file after date of last furnishing.

What are the Bonneville County Recorder fees to file a lien?

Here are the costs to file a mechanics lien in Bonneville County, Idaho:
$10 for the first page. $3 for each additional page

Recording offices do update their fee structure periodically. We recommend contacting the Bonneville County Recorder to verify the recording costs, especially before mailing a document.

How do I release a lien in Bonneville County once I’ve been paid?

To cancel a lien previously recorded with the Bonneville County Recorder, you will need to record a lien release.
Lien release fee:
$10.
